SOIL MECHANICS TESTING SYSTEMS
In all sections of civil engineering and particularly in soil mechanics, the engi-
neer during the design stage must ensure that the analysis of soil properties
relate directly to the relevant foundation or structure. Using procedures invol-
ving extracting, examining and testing representative samples the engineer
can compute a model very close to the real situation. In recent years we have
seen a significant contribution to experimental analysis resulting from more
sophisticated testing procedures, updating of many International Standards
and publication of good testing manuals and procedures.

WYKEHAM FARRANCE was originally formed in 1941 by Geoff Wykeham and
Geoff Farrance. The original company is now part of the CONTROLS GROUP as
the Soil Mechanics Division.

IntroductionThe residual shear strength of soils issometimes also termed the ultimateshear strength. This is the strength ofsoil when it is sheared to large dis-placements, for example along thefailure plane of a landslide or in afault zone. A remoulded specimen isused to determine the residual shearproperties of the soil. A slip surface isformed in the test specimen as part ofthe test procedure.It can also be useful to know what sortof value the residual shear strength ofan intact soil can have, because this(when taken in conjunction with thepeak shear strength of the same soil)indicates its brittleness or susceptibilityto progressive failure. Soils with highbrittleness need to be used with cautionin engineering works such as embank-ments (or treated with caution if theycannot be removed, for example in anatural slope).In the unfortunate event of a slopefailure occurring, the general scale ofdisplacement will depend on the mag-nitude of the brittleness.

General description
The TORSHEAR ring shear apparatus teststhe residual shear strength of remouldedannular soil samples. The main advantage ofthis method compared to the direct sheartest consists in the continuous shear with aconstant area during all the test long. Thismethod allows us to recreate in the labora-tory exactly the field conditions, giving veryaccurate residual shear stress values. Thesample is loaded vertically between twoporous stones by means of a counter balance10: 1 ratio lever loading system. A rotation isimparted to the base plate and lower platenby means of a variable speed motor. The set-tlement of the upper platen during consoli-dation or shear can be monitored by meansof a sensitive dial gauge or linear transducerbearing on the top of the load hanger.Torque transmitted to the sample is reactedby a pair of matched load measuring provingrings or load cells. IntroductionTo design foundations, embankmentsand other soil structures, GeotechnicalEngineers require methods of assess-ing the mechanical properties of soils.For over 60 years Wykeam Farrance,now incorporated in the CONTROLSGroup, has been at the forefront ofthe development of test systemsdesigned to give engineers the infor-mation they require.Since the development of the first com-mercially produced shear box machinein the 1950s, we have been workingclosely with leading Academics andUniversities to produce testing systemsthat further advance the understand-ing of soil mechanics. The experimental investigation usedto determine the stress-strain relationis usually carried out with triaxialtests, where undisturbed soil specimenare subjected to different stress levelsand drainage conditions to simulate asclose as possible the different situa-tions that can occur in the subsoil onsite because of the effect of buildingconstructions, excavations, tunnelling,etc.Our geotechnical division manufac-tures a large sophisticated state of theart range of triaxial equipment, whichis detailed above.

Total stress measurementUnconsolidated Undrained (UU) tests
With this method the shear strength is measured with respect to total stress. The soilspecimen (assumed saturated) is not allowed to consolidate, maintains its originalstructure and water content, so that its resistance only depends on the level of geo-static stress in the field. Tests are usually carried out on three specimens of the samesample, subjected to different confining pressure. Provided that the soil is fully sat-urated, the shear strength is the same for each test.The Mohr envelope, plotted with respect to total stress is horizontal and the shearstrength is constant and equal to Cu (undrained shear strength).
Effective stress measurementConsolidated Undrained (CU) tests
With this test method the shear strength is measured in terms of effective stress. Atleast three specimens are saturated, allowed to consolidate (i.e. to change its struc-ture and water content) at different level of confining pressure before failure. Due tothe fact that shear strength increases raising the effective stresses the Coulomb’smodel can be applied in terms of effective stress:
? = c’ + ?’n tg ?’where: ? = shear resistance?’n = effective normal stressc’, ?’ = parameters of Mohr envelope in terms of effective stress
During the failure stage the specimen is not allowed to drain and pore pressure ismeasured, so that the effective stresses are calculated as the difference between thetotal stress and the pore pressure.
Effective stress measurement Consolidated Drained (CD) tests
This test method is similar to the “CU” test as the shear strength can be related to theapplied level of stress. At least three specimens are allowed to consolidate at differ-ent levels of confining pressure. The failure stage is carried out very slowly to preventthe increase of pore pressure inside the specimen, which is allowed to drain. The totaland effective stresses are the same. Mohr circles are drawn for effective stresses atfailure and the parameters c’ and ?’ are determined from the Mohr envelope.

ON SAMPLE STRAIN TRANSDUCERS
Consist of two axial and one radial transduc-ers. In conventional triaxial testing thedetermination of axial stiffness is based onexternal measurements. This method bringserrors due to sample bedding effects of theporous stones on either end of the sampleand to the loading system and load measur-ing system. Furthermore the two ends of the specimenare subjected to restraint, differently fromthe middle third of the sample, where thestrain transducers are mounted and wherethe realistic deformations occur.Axial and radial strain transducers give theopportunity to measure with high accuracythe deformations directly on the triaxial testspecimen. Applications
Bender elements allow to measure the max-imum shear modulus (Gmax) of a soil sampleand from this data to evaluate the stiffnessof a soil. Gmax is generally associated withshear strain levels of about 0.001% and is akey parameter in small strain dynamic analy-ses, such as those to predict soil behaviour orsoil structure interaction during earth-quakes, explosion or machine and trafficvibrations.
General description
The piezoceramic bender element is an elec-tro-mechanical transducer, which is capableof converting mechanical energy (move-ment) either to or from electrical energy. Thesingle bender element consists of two thinpiezoceramic plates, which are rigidly bond-ed together with conducting surfacesbetween them and on the outsides.
The polarisation of the ceramic material ineach plate and the electrical connections aresuch that when a driving voltage is appliedto the element, one plate elongates and theother shortens. The net result is a bendingdisplacement, which is greater in magnitudethan the length change in either of the twolayers. On the other hand, when the bender ele-ment is forced to bend, one layer will go intotension and the other into compression: thiswill result in an electrical signal, which canbe measured. In the soil application the bender elementsare encapsulated and mounted into inserts,which are fixed into the pedestal and topcap of a triaxial cell. They protrude edge-firstinto the soil specimen as cantilevered. Whenexcited the bender element bends from sideto side pushing the soil in a direction per-pendicular to the length of the element andthus having a large coupling factor with thesoil. This produces a shear wave, which prop-agates parallel to the length of the element
into the soil sample. On the other end of thesoil sample another bender element is forcedto bend and produces an electrical signalthat can be measured.Theory on shear wave propagation in anelastic body tells us that the value of theshear modulus Gmax of the soil from meas-urement of shear wave velocity Vs is givenby:
Gmax = ρ • (Vs)2
where ρ is the mass density of the soil sam-ple. The system consists of a transmitter,which is energised to produce the shearwaves through the soil sample, and thereceiver that receive the electrical signal. Thetravel time of the shear wave from thetransmitter to the receiver is determined viaa specific software that allows the user toquickly and easily calculate the shear wavevelocity.The complete power and measuring system28-WF4190 includes:- Wareform generator- Analog-to-PC interface- Virtual oscilloscope software- Connecting cables

IntroductionMost books and courses in soilmechanics assume that soils are fullysaturated, but in most parts of theworld soils exist in an unsaturatedstate. This is particularly true in tropi-cal and arid regions; even in temper-ate climatic zones, soils above thewater table can remain unsaturated. A saturated soil is one where all thevoids between the soil particles arefilled with water. An unsaturated soilcontains both air and water within thesoil voids. The presence of surfacetension forces at the interfacebetween the air and water within anunsaturated soil allows different pres-sures to exist in the air and the water.In an unsaturated soil in the field, thepore air pressure is usually at atmos-pheric pressure and the pore waterpressure is lower than the air pressure. Since we normally treat atmosphericpressure as zero pressure, that makesthe pore water pressure negative (sinceit will be less than atmospheric). Wecall this negative pressure “suction”since, if the soil is put in contact withwater at atmospheric pressure, it willsuck water into the soil.
The unsaturated layer can extend togreat depths, which is governed byenvironmental conditions. The valueof suction is what determines thestrength of the unsaturated material. It is when this suction changes thatunsaturated soil can behave different-ly to that expected of a saturated soil,for example collapsible soils, wherethe change in moisture content canproduce a sudden reduction in volumeand also have a dramatic effect on thestrength of the material.The fundamental difference betweenthe triaxial testing of a soil sample ina saturated condition compared to anunsaturated condition can be sum-marised as follows:

• The behaviour of a saturated soil iscontrolled entirely by total stressand pore water pressure (througheffective stress). The positive porewater pressures are pushing the par-ticles apart and hence reduce thestrength of the soil.
• In an unsaturated soil both air andwater fill the voids, and surface ten-sion forces create a negative porewater pressure (or suction). Thissuction pulls the soil particlestogether and increases the strengthof the soil.
WF catalogo UK 2 07-2013:WF catalogo OK corretto 17-07-2013 15:39 Pagina 46
47Soil Mechanics Division of CONTROLS
Geotechnical: TriaxialUnsaturated Testing
28
Some examples of application
• Rainfall induced landslideSlopes may stand at steep angles when theyare supported by suctions and these impartadditional shear strength on the soil. Whenrain infiltrates the slope, the suctions reduceand the slope falls due to a loss of shearstrength.
• Swelling soilsThe volume change of expansive soils is con-trolled by the suction changes that take placeas a result of water ingress. Swelling causesdifferential movements in structures, whichcan cause extensive cracking.
• Collapsing soils Loose clayey soils may be held in a loose stablestate by the presence of suction. If water pen-etrates the soil the suction is reduced and theloose fabric can become unstable. Large vol-ume reduction can take place suddenly andthese cause disruption and damage to struc-tures.

Description
In the traditional triaxial systems, where satu-rated samples are tested, the volume changemeasurement is a simple monitoring of thewater entering or leaving the sample by a vol-ume change transducer.On the contrary, in the unsaturated systemsvolume change measurements are complicatedby the compressibility of air. If an increase ofconfining pressure is applied to an unsaturatedsample, a movement of water out of the sam-ple will occur but at the same time the size willchange due to the compression of the air inthe voids. A correct measurement requires the volume ofwater leaving the sample and the total volumechange of the sample as shown in the sketch. With these two measurements, by differencethe volume change due to water beingsqueezed out of the sample and the volumechange due to the compressibility of air can bedetermined.A double walled triaxial cell can be the solu-tion: the same pressure inside and outside ofthe inner cell wall will produce zero expansion

Axis translation method with High AirEntry Stone (H.A.E.S.)
One of the problems when a sample with a highsuction is to be tested, is to prevent the samplefrom sucking the water from the porous stoneon the base pedestal and cause cavitation in thetriaxial cell pore water measuring system. Toprevent this happening the porous disc has beenreplaced with a high air entry stone, cemented
into the base pedestal. The high air entry stonewill allow water to pass through but not air, atvarious values. For example, a 5 bar stone willnot allow air under 5 bar pressure to passthrough the stone. The stone is cemented intothe base pedestal to prevent water passingaround the outside of the stone. The saturatedstone will then allow the passage of water butnot air. This will make it very difficult for thewater to be sucked out of the stone; it will stopair entering the stone but it will not stop cavi-tation under the stone. This requires anothermodification to our triaxial system. To stop cav-itation happening and to enable the suction tobe measured, an air pressure is applied to thepore space in the sample. Suction is caused bythe surface tension forces providing a differencein pressure between the air and the water pres-sure. If the air pressure is zero (atmospheric)then the water pressures will be negative. If weincrease the air pressure in the pore space, the
WF catalogo UK 2 07-2013:WF catalogo OK corretto 17-07-2013 15:39 Pagina 47
water pressure will also increase, keeping thedifference between the air and water pressuresthe same. The air pressure is increased until thewater pressure becomes positive. The suction isstill maintained because the water pressure isstill lower than the air pressure. The air pressureis applied via the top cap (in the same way as awater back pressure in a saturated test) at about200 kPa below the air entry value of the porousstone. This will raise the pressure inside thesample to a positive value and in turn will applya positive pressure to the porous stone and thepore water pressure transducer.

LiquefactionLiquefaction is a phenomenon that occurs insaturated soils, in which the space betweenindividual particles is completely filled withwater. This water exerts a pressure on thesoil particles that influences how tightly theparticles themselves are pressed together.Prior to an earthquake, the water pressure isrelatively low. However, earthquake shakingcan cause the water pressure to increase tothe point where the soil particles can readilymove with respect to each other. During thelast three decades progress has been made intheoretical and experimental aspects ofresearch concerning phenomenon of lique-faction.
The phenomena and problems associatedwith liquefaction concern saturated cohe-sionless soils, even if they contain consider-able amount of fines. In recent years partic-ular attention has been focused on slopingground conditions, which although do notrequire earthquake loading, might result inflow failure associated with catastrophicconsequences.

RESONANT COLUMN combines the fea-tures of both resonant column and torsio-nal shear into a single unit including thecurrent driven motor to apply torsionalload to sample, a series of transducers withsignal conditioning, a cell and back pressu-re electro-pneumatic control system and adata logger.In the Resonant Column test a cylindricalsoil specimen is restrained at the bottomand dynamically excited at the top. Thetorsional force at the top is generatedusing an electrical motor constituted byeight drive coils encircling four magnetsattached to a drive plate. The generatedfrequency is up to 250 Hz. The fundamen-tal mode of vibration is found from themaximum amplitude of motion; from theresonant frequency, shear wave velocity
31-WF8500
and shear wave modulus are calculatedusing elasticity theory. The correspondingshear strain is evaluated from the motionamplitude. Material damping can be deter-mined from the half power bandwidth orfrom a free-vibration decay curve, which isgenerated by shutting off the drivingpower.In the Torsional Simple Shear test the soilspecimen is deformed cyclically at a lowfrequency (a maximum of 10 Hz), continu-ously monitoring torque and deformation.From the torque-deformation curves, arelationship between average shear stressand average shear strain is obtained, whichin turn provides the shear modulus and thedamping ratio.

Resonant Column test (RC)A signal generator supplies a sinusoidal volt-age to the driving amplifier and a propor-tional current to the coils attached to thecell body. The magnetic field in the coilsinteracts with the magnets attached to thedriving plate, that in turn conveys a torsion-al oscillation to the top of the specimen. Asthe frequency of the input signal varies, thedynamic response of the specimen results ina varying motion amplitude. The amplitudeis captured either by an accelerometerattached to the driving plate and by proxim-ity displacement transducers measuring therelative movement of the driving plate rela-tive to the coils. The frequency that maximizes the motion ofthe top of the specimen is associated to thefirst-mode resonance and is found applyingan input signal with a frequency sweep. Thesecant shear modulus of the soil can be eval-
uated from the resonant frequency. Thedamping ratio can be evaluated either fromthe complete frequency response of the soilspecimen (“half power band width”), or froma free-vibration decay curve that is generat-ed by shutting off the driving power.At a given consolidation effective stress, RCtests are repeated several times, increasingprogressively the amplitude of the inputvoltage, thus obtaining the secant shearmodulus and the damping ratio correspon-ding to increasing shear strain values.
Torsional Simple Shear test (TSS)A sinusoidal current is applied to the coils ina quasi-static condition and the motion ofthe top of the specimen is monitored usingthe proximity displacement transducers. Theinput current (proportional to the shearstress) and the corresponding torsional rota-tion (proportional to the shear strain) aresimultaneously recorded. The shear modulusof the soil is determined from the average
slope of the stress-strain loops, while mate-rial damping is related to the area of thehysteresis loop.At a given consolidation effective stress, TSStests are repeated several times, increasingprogressively the amplitude of the inputvoltage, thus obtaining the secant shearmodulus and the damping ratio correspon-ding to increasing values of the shear strain.
TEST STAGES
Saturation stageDuring saturation stage a small amount ofcell and back pressures are applied in steps,with a consequent dissolution of the aircontained in the intergaranular spaces. Acontrol system generate the cell and backpressures using air/water interfaces. Cell,back and pore pressures are measured bypressure transducers 1000kPa cap, 0.1 kPaaccuracy. Volume change is measured usinghigh sensitivity differential pressure trans-ducer.Consolidation stageThe sample is subjected to the same backpressure used during the last saturation stepwhile the cell pressure depends on the effec-tive stress required in the next steps. Whenpore water pressure and volume changesare completely dissipated the consolidationstage ends.During this stage the axial strain is measuredusing a LVDT transducer ± 12.5 mm travel,0,2% class.
RC and TSS tests are usually performed inundrained conditions, closing the drainagechannels and measuring changes in the porewater pressure.
